  • Title

    Multi-resolution meshes for multiple target, single content adaptation within the MPEG-21 framework

  • Abstract
    To present three-dimensional data both in heavy and light-weight clients, an adaptation scheme is required. Current state-of-the art research shows promising results for specific purposes but it is still not well adoptable for light-weight clients such as mobile devices. In this research, we present a method for transmitting adapted 3D content to multiple target devices. To accomplish this goal, we devised a clustered representation of a multi-resolution model that is flexible, simple, efficient, and works with the MPEG-21 adaptation mechanism.
